Offered By: IBMSkillsNetwork
Getting Started with Git and GitHub
Learn the fundamental skills to develop applications collaboratively with the Version Control Systems Git and GitHub. Explore key concepts, including branching and repositories; practice forking, cloning, and merging workflows. Build up your portfolio with a final project.
Continue readingCourse
Cloud Development
At a Glance
Learn the fundamental skills to develop applications collaboratively with the Version Control Systems Git and GitHub. Explore key concepts, including branching and repositories; practice forking, cloning, and merging workflows. Build up your portfolio with a final project.
What you will learn
- Describe the relevance of version control and code repositories in a DevOps environment and culture.
- Explain fundamental version control concepts such as branching used for distributed, and social coding.
- Create GitHub repositories with branches, perform pull requests (PRs), and merge operations, which allow you to collaborate on a team project.
- Showcase your skills by sharing an open-source, public project on GitHub.
Prerequisites
Course Syllabus:
- Overview of Version Control, Git, and GitHub
- Introduction to GitHub
- GitHub Repositories
- GitHub – Getting Started
- Hands-on Lab: GitHub Sign Up & Create Repo
- GitHub Branches and Pull Requests
- Hands-on Lab: Branching and Merging (Web UI)
- Getting Started with Branches Using Git Commands
- Cloning and Forking GitHub Projects
- More about Cloning and Forking
- Managing GitHub Projects
- Hands-On Lab: Cloning and Forking GitHub Projects
- Part 1 – GitHub UI
- Part 2 – Git CLI
Estimated Effort
10 Hours
Level
Beginner
Industries
Information Technology
Skills You Will Learn
Cloning And Forking, Distributed Version Control Systems, Git, GitHub, Open Source
Language
English
Course Code
CD0131EN